Data source unreachable

I have created a PBI report in the desktop version using excel files from OneDrive and dataset from Azure. In the desktop version all works well, but when I publish it I get an error. The "File" hyperlink just sends me back to the main page. And according to my IT team, there's no Gateway for Azure report. 

 

I have tried to publish a report with just excel files from OD or just some tables and measures from Azure - it works. But when I publish the combination of these two, the visuals don't work.

 

I have checked other threads here but nothing seems to help.
